Ka aha tō rā e kite ai? - What will your day look like?
As a Master Scheduler, you will be accountable for:
- Developing and maintaining an integrated master schedule in Microsoft Project across multiple initiatives and vendors.
- Defining and managing the programme Work Breakdown Structure (WBS), key milestones, dependencies, and critical path.
- Monitoring programme progress, identifying schedule variances, and providing impact analysis and recommendations.
- Aligning Jira-based agile delivery tracking with the overall programme schedule.
- Producing schedule reports, dashboards, and insights for senior stakeholders and governance forums.
- Partnering with Programme Managers, Initiative Leads, and vendors to ensure accurate and timely schedule updates.
- Supporting scenario planning and risk identification to enhance delivery outcomes.
- Establishing scheduling standards, templates, and best practices to improve schedule accuracy and predictability.
- Coaching delivery teams on the effective use of Microsoft Project and scheduling processes.
Ōu Pūkenga? - What will you bring?
To be successful in this role, you will ideally bring:
- Proven experience in programme scheduling within large-scale transformation programmes
- Advanced Microsoft Project skills, including master schedules and linked subprojects
- Strong knowledge of critical path analysis, dependency management, and schedule reporting
- Experience consolidating agile delivery data (e.g., Jira) into integrated programme schedules
- Excellent stakeholder management and communication skills
- Experience supporting banking or financial services transformation initiatives
- Familiarity with vendor-led software implementation projects
- Understanding of PMO governance, reporting frameworks, and programme controls
